A 39-year-old investor celebrates the end of debt while starting a dollar-cost averaging (DCA) approach to Bitcoin, entering the market at a price of $66,000. This decision comes on the heels of a nearly 50% market drop, raising questions about timing strategies and long-term implications.

The Personal Context

After spending three years renovating his home, the investor found himself debt-free as of last Friday, allowing him to redirect his financial focus towards crypto investments. With a minimal portfolio of less than €200 prior, he’s now set to engage seriously in the market.

Ambitious Steps Forward

"I know I can never time the market," he emphasized, aware that Bitcoin could fall back to $35,000 or $40,000. His cautious but hopeful stance echoes sentiments shared across various online forums where like-minded individuals gather to discuss such ventures.

Other participants expressed their own experiences:

  • "That’s why I’m on this board. I have no one to discuss BTC with," remarked one person, highlighting a common struggle among crypto enthusiasts.

  • Another note: "Welcome to the club. DCA is the least stressful way to stack sats," reinforcing the emotional support these forums provide.

  • Intriguingly, one user suggested an investment strategy linked to a cryptocurrency's 200-week moving average, promoting a disciplined approach to buying under market dips.

"Set it and forget it - automate your buys so emotions don’t derail your strategy," advised another forum member, stressing the importance of consistency over panic-driven decisions.
